§ 34-18-8-3 — Demand; reasonable damages

Indiana·Title 34 CIVIL LAW AND PROCEDURE·Art. 18 MEDICAL MALPRACTICE·Ch. 8 Commencement of a Medical Malpractice Action
Except for the declaration called for in section 6(a) of this chapter, a dollar amount or figure may not be included in the demand in a malpractice complaint, but the prayer must be for such damages as are reasonable in the premises. [Pre-1998 Recodification Citation: 27-12-8-3.]

Legislative History

As added by P.L.1-1998, SEC.13.
